What is acceptance testing?


Q: What is acceptance testing?

A: Acceptance testing is black box testing that gives the client, customer, or project manager the opportunity to verify the system's functionality and usability before the system is released to production. The acceptance test is the responsibility of the client, customer, or project manager, however, it is conducted with the full support of the test team. The test team also works with the client, customer, project manager to develop the acceptance criteria.
